Dr. Nabiha Ali Khan Calls Her Second Marriage the Biggest Mistake of Her Life

Pakistani psychologist, former news anchor, and digital creator Dr. Nabiha Ali Khan has sparked a wave of conversation online after making a deeply personal confession on a popular podcast.

Dr. Nabiha Ali Khan is a renowned Pakistani psychologist and former news anchor who rose to prominence through her TV and digital media appearances, particularly because of her many viral statements. She graduated in Psychology and often speaks about human psychology and behaviour on various platforms.

Dr. Nabiha Khan’s first husband passed away years ago, and she has a son from her first marriage. In November 2025, she remarried her friend and colleague, Haris Khokhar.

Recently, Dr. Nabiha appeared on The Jawan Pakistan podcast, where she was asked about the one life decision she regrets the most. While she stopped short of naming the decision directly, her words left little to the imagination.

She said that she has made very few mistakes in life, but one particular mistake has caused her great suffering. She added that she will now follow her heart and deal with the consequences herself, a statement widely interpreted as a reference to her second marriage.

She also revealed, “The person you love makes you feel worthless,” adding that she considers it Allah’s special blessing that whenever someone behaves hypocritically with her, Allah exposes that person in front of her.

The candid remarks quickly went viral, with many fans expressing sympathy and admiration for her honesty. The revelation has reignited public discussion about second marriages, emotional healing, and the courage it takes to speak one’s truth, especially for a woman in the public eye.
